Experts reveal link between cancer and obesity
Wednesday 05 November 2008
In a timely pre-Christmas gluttony warning, a cancer expert has revealed that the number of people suffering from cancer could double within the next 40 years unless steps are taken to stem rising obesity.
Professor Martin Wiseman, of the World Cancer Research Fund, explains: “The evidence now shows that, after not smoking, maintaining a healthy weight is the most important thing you can do for cancer prevention.”
Links have been found between excess body fat and cancer of the bowel, breast, womb, oesophagus, kidney and pancreas, so following a healthy, balanced diet has never been more important.
